This Plain Language Summary of publication article (PLSP) from Future Oncology summarizes the latest results from the monarchE study, which involved participants with HR+, HER2-, node-positive, high-risk early breast cancer. The study compared outcomes between those who received abemaciclib with standard endocrine therapy after surgery and those who received endocrine therapy alone. It aimed to determine if abemaciclib reduced cancer recurrence compared to standard treatment alone.
